The Harrison Firefighters Pension Board of Directors met on Tuesday, Jan. 28, for one of three annual meetings. They invited Mollie McCammon to share the details about her late husband, Captain Jim McCammon's name being added to the Arkansas Fallen Firefighters' Memorial in Little Rock on Saturday, March 29, at 1 p.m. The public is invited. The ceremony will also be available on Facebook.
